Agriculture Scheme Payments

Dáil Éireann Debate, Tuesday - 30 May 2017

Tuesday, 30 May 2017

Ceisteanna (545)

Charlie McConalogue

Ceist:

545. Deputy Charlie McConalogue asked the Minister for Agriculture, Food and the Marine the reason a person's (details supplied) farm payments have been frozen and have been directed to a bank;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[25773/17]

Amharc ar fhreagra

Freagraí scríofa

Where the Department is served with court orders, including Orders of Garnishee and orders for the appointment of receivers by way of equitable execution, the Department takes all necessary steps to comply with the specific terms of such orders.

The Department was served with a Conditional Order dated 6 March 2017 against a person with the same name and address as supplied with this question. The Order did not specify a herd number. A search of the Department's records indicated only one account with this name and address. The Department has since sought clarification from the Plaintiff's legal team and corrective action has been taken.  

I can confirm that no payments have been directed to a bank in this case as no payments became due to the herdowner since the Conditional Order was received.
